Improved Tree Vitality
Consistent tree maintenance considerably boosts the total health of trees, encouraging their longevity and resilience against diseases and pests. Routine pruning eliminates dead or diseased branches, permitting trees to allocate resources more effectively. This practice also improves air circulation and sunlight exposure, promoting strong growth. Scheduled inspections by professionals can detect potential problems early, such as infestations or nutrient deficiencies, allowing timely intervention. Additionally, proper watering and mulching techniques promote root development and soil health, further strengthening the tree's immune system. By investing in regular tree care, property owners can confirm their trees remain vibrant and strong, effectively reducing the likelihood of serious health problems that could lead to expensive removals or replacements in the future.

Essential Examinations and Services for Tree Condition
Sustaining tree health demands thorough assessments and specific treatments, as even small issues can develop into major problems if left unaddressed. Professional arborists perform comprehensive evaluations to recognize signs of disease, pest infestations, or nutrient deficiencies. These assessments frequently involve inspecting bark, leaves, and root systems to assess the overall vitality of the tree.
When issues are identified, suitable treatments are implemented. This may encompass the application of fertilizers to address nutrient deficiencies, fungicides to control diseases, or insecticides to handle pests. In some cases, more specialized techniques such as soil aeration or root zone management are used to encourage healthier growth.
Routine monitoring and follow-up assessments guarantee that treatments are producing results and that the tree continues to grow healthily. By giving priority to these vital evaluations and interventions, tree owners can substantially improve the longevity and resilience of their landscape's arboreal assets.

Signs of Medical Conditions
A thriving landscape depends on the vitality of its trees, making it essential to recognize the symptoms of disease that may point to the need for removal. Tree owners should be watchful for indicators such as discolored or wilting leaves, which may signal underlying health problems. Additionally, unusual growths like fungi or cankers on the bark can signal infections that compromise structural soundness. The presence of pests, such as borers or scales, often leads to significant deterioration if left untreated. Unexpected leaf shedding or dieback in branches can further suggest severe stress or illness. If multiple warning signs appear, it may be time to seek out a professional arborist to assess the situation and determine whether removal is the most wise course of action.
Problems Related to Structural Instability
While evaluating the health of a landscape, structural instability in trees can pose significant risks that may warrant removal. Evidence of instability include visible lean, extensive root damage, or trunk cracks, which can compromise the tree's ability to withstand environmental stresses. If a tree exhibits a significant lean towards structures or high-traffic areas, the risk of failure increases, especially during storms or high winds. Furthermore, trees with hollow trunks or extensive decay may not support their weight adequately, further raising the hazard. Homeowners should consider these factors carefully, as failing to address structural instability can result in property damage or personal injury. Engaging a certified arborist can provide valuable insights into whether removal is the safest option.
Proximity to Structures
The nearness to buildings can significantly affect the decision to remove a tree, especially when there are structural integrity issues. Trees located near dwellings, footpaths, or service lines pose considerable threats, as their roots can weaken foundations and their branches may interfere with overhead lines. In addition, if a tree is inclined toward a structure or exhibiting evidence of rot, removal becomes a sensible choice. The likelihood of damage during inclement weather or gale-force winds further makes more difficult the decision-making process. Property owners ought to seek advice from tree care professionals to analyze the scenario, considering the tree's health against its proximity to essential structures. In the end, proactive measures can avoid costly repairs and safeguard the safety of the landscape and surrounding property.

Which Credentials Must Tree Service Professionals Obtain?
Professional arborists must possess certifications such as ISA Arborist Certification, TCIA Accreditation, and locally mandated licenses. Such qualifications indicate expertise in tree care, safety practices, and conformity to industry standards, providing consistent and skilled service.
